Business principle:
AngloGold as an employer: our labour practices
AngloGold is committed to upholding the Fundamental Rights Conventions of the International Labour Organization (ILO). Accordingly, we seek to ensure the implementation of fair employment practices by prohibiting forced, compulsory or child labour.
AngloGold is committed to creating workplaces free of harassment and unfair discrimination.
As an international company, we face different challenges in different countries with regard to, for example, offering opportunities to citizens who may not have enjoyed equal opportunities in the past. In such cases, the company is committed to addressing the challenge in a manner appropriate to the local circumstances.
We will seek to understand the different cultural dynamics in host communities and adapt work practices to accommodate this where doing so is possible and compatible with the principles expressed in this document.
The company will promote the development of a work force that reflects the international and local diversity of the organisation.
The company will provide all employees with the opportunity to participate in training that will improve their workplace competency.
The company is committed to ensuring that every employee has the opportunity to become numerate and functionally literate in the language of the workplace.
The company is committed to developing motivated, competent and experienced teams of employees through appropriate recruitment and retention and development initiatives. Emphasis is placed on the identification of potential talent, mentoring and personal development planning.
Remuneration systems will reward both individual and team effort in a meaningful way.
Guided by local circumstances, we shall continue to work together with stakeholders to ensure minimum standards for company-provided accommodation.
The company assures access to affordable health care for employees and where possible, for their families.
We are committed to prompt and supportive action in response to any major health threats in the regions in which we operate.
